Output 39caa0eb62a829bc5214a6de561a3760203c38c45c2719802ff30777e530cce9:3

value
26598316
script pubkey
OP_0 OP_PUSHBYTES_20 4723fc26f3521dbe9a57ebbee5b214b4761de1b7
address
bc1qgu3lcfhn2gwmaxjhawlwtvs5k3mpmcdhuxsnrw
transaction
39caa0eb62a829bc5214a6de561a3760203c38c45c2719802ff30777e530cce9